21xrx.com
2024-12-22 22:37:06 Sunday
登录
文章检索 我的文章 写文章
C++中如何实现跳出本次循环?
2023-07-07 10:54:43 深夜i     --     --
C++ 跳出 循环

在C++中,跳出本次循环可以通过使用关键字continue来实现。当循环执行到continue语句时,程序会跳过当前循环中余下的代码,立即执行下一次循环。下面是一个使用continue语句来实现跳出循环的例子:

  for(int i=0; i<10; i++) {

    if(i == 3 || i == 7)

      continue;

    cout << i << endl;

  }

在上面的例子中,在i等于3或7时,程序会执行continue语句,跳过输出i的代码,然后执行下一次循环。因此,输出的结果将是0、1、2、4、5、6、8、9。

除了使用continue语句,C++还提供了其他的方式来跳出循环。其中,使用break语句可以立即跳出循环,不再继续执行任何循环语句。例如:

  for(int i=0; i<10; i++) {

    if(i == 5)

      break;

    cout << i << endl;

  }

在上面的例子中,在i等于5时,程序会执行break语句,直接跳出循环,不再继续执行循环体内的任何语句。因此,输出的结果将是0、1、2、3、4。

总之,C++中提供了多种方式来跳出循环。在使用这些语句时,需要根据具体需求来选择最合适的方式。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复